Term Gamstorp-Wohlfart syndrome ID (Ontology) DOID:0050526 (Human Disease)
Definition A syndrome characterized by progressive weakness and atrophy of muscles in feet, legs and hands. In some patients the syndrome also causes decreased sensitivity to touch, heat or cold, particularly in the lower arms or legs.
Also Known As "autosomal recessive neuromyotonia and axonal neuropathy" ; "myokymia, myotonia and muscle wasting"
